About Us

At NeuLife Rehabilitation, Inc. we specialize in person-centered care for individuals with traumatic brain injuries and spinal cord injuries. Our team is committed to delivering compassionate, high-quality support that promotes independence, safety, and dignity for every person we serve.

Position Summary

We are seeking a dedicated Direct Care Staff professional with experience supporting individuals with TBI and SCI in a residential or rehabilitation setting. This role requires hands-on support with daily living activities, mobility assistance, behavioral support, and medication management under clinical oversight.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ide direct care assistance, including bathing, dressing, grooming, toileting, feeding, and mobility support
  • Monitor and document behavioral, emotional, and physical changes
  • Assist with range-of-motion exercises and transfers (including use of assistive devices)
  • Ensure safe and accurate medication administration in accordance with training and protocols
  • Support individuals with behavioral challenges using de-escalation and redirection techniques
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and structured living environment
  • Accurately complete documentation, shift notes, and incident reports
  • Collaborate with nursing, therapy, and case management teams to support individualized care plans
Qualifications
  • High school diploma or GED required
  • Minimum 1 year of experience working with individuals with TBI or SCI preferred
  • Certified Medication Aide (CMA) or Med Tech certification preferred or required by state regulations
  • Current CPR and First Aid certification (or ability to obtain)
  • Ability to lift, transfer, and physically assist individuals with mobility limitations
  • Strong observational, communication, and teamwork skills
  • Commitment to maintaining confidentiality and professional boundaries
